There is USAG (DP, Xcel, T&T and the rest), USAIGC, AAU, and NGA. There are also other smaller regional ones out there.
You can't really say much about them controlling who goes to the Olympics because there is only one NGB (National Governing Body) for each country.
USAIGC is a program whose focus is college-bound. Lower hours so you have more time for acadmics and the levels are designed with NCAA readiness in mind. Although I can't think of any off the top of my head, there are IGC girls who go on to compete in NCAA.
